Natural ingredients — cassava roots, tapioca starch, potatoes and vegetable oil Lab-Tested Formula
100% Plant-Based Food-Grade Materials
100% Plant-Based

Natural Ingredients,
Engineered Responsibly

Our products are manufactured using one hundred percent plant-based, food-grade materials that deliver high performance while protecting the environment. Tapioca (cassava) starch offers exceptional paste viscosity, clarity and adhesiveness, making it one of the most reliable natural materials for sustainable manufacturing.

Sustainability Comparison

Plastic vs Degradable vs Compostable

A simple comparison illustrating why fully compostable materials provide a safer and more sustainable solution.

Criteria Plastic Degradable Recommended Compostable ETG ECO GREEN
Raw Material Petroleum-based Petroleum-based Organic Materials
Breakdown Time 100+ Years Only Under Specific Conditions Within Months
Microplastic Residue Yes Yes None
Human & Wildlife Safety Harmful Harmful Completely Safe
BPA May Contain BPA May Contain BPA BPA Free
Environmental Impact High Moderate Minimal
